ZURICH, SWITZERLAND: Late legendary musician Tina Turner, who died on May 24 aged 83, suffered a lifetime of heartache when it came to her mother, Zelma Priscilla. The mother-daughter duo shared a complicated relationship throughout Turner’s life, even when she established herself as the Queen of Rock ‘n’ Roll, until Priscilla's death in 1999 at the age of 81.
